Introduction

Givenchy, a name synonymous with luxury, elegance, and sophistication, has long been a stalwart in the world of high fashion. Founded in 1952 by the renowned French aristocrat and fashion designer, Count Hubert James Marcel Taffin de Givenchy, the house of Givenchy has since become a global icon in the realms of fashion and perfume. In this article, we delve into the rich history, evolution, and lasting legacy of Givenchy, exploring the brand's origins, key figures, and significant contributions to the world of haute couture.

Givenchy: A Visionary in Fashion

Hubert de Givenchy, pronounced [ybɛʁ də ʒivɑ̃ʃi], was born on February 20, 1927, in Beauvais, France. From a young age, Givenchy displayed a keen eye for design and an innate sense of style. His aristocratic background and refined taste would ultimately shape the aesthetic of his eponymous fashion house. Givenchy's foray into the world of fashion began when he moved to Paris in the early 1940s to pursue his passion for design.

In 1952, Givenchy founded his eponymous fashion house, Givenchy, which quickly gained acclaim for its timeless elegance and modern sensibility. The brand's debut collection showcased Givenchy's signature blend of sophistication and innovation, setting the stage for a long and illustrious career in the fashion industry.

The History of Givenchy: A Tale of Elegance and Innovation

The history of Givenchy is a testament to the brand's commitment to luxury, craftsmanship, and innovation. From its early days in the 1950s to its present-day status as a global fashion powerhouse, Givenchy has consistently pushed the boundaries of design and creativity.

One of Givenchy's most iconic creations is the "little black dress," a timeless and versatile garment that has become a staple in women's wardrobes around the world. Givenchy's innovative approach to design, coupled with his impeccable attention to detail, has cemented his legacy as one of the most influential figures in the history of fashion.

Exploring the Origins and Evolution of Givenchy

The evolution of Givenchy as a brand is a testament to its ability to adapt and innovate in an ever-changing fashion landscape. Over the years, Givenchy has expanded its offerings to include a wide range of products, from ready-to-wear clothing to accessories, perfumes, and cosmetics.

One of Givenchy's most enduring legacies is its line of perfumes, which have become synonymous with luxury and refinement. Parfums Givenchy, the brand's fragrance division, has produced a diverse range of scents that capture the essence of Givenchy's timeless elegance and sophistication.
